Transaction 375fcf724e523e138e4e8de12b714fe3620b84ed7814106bc29aa9c3896aa723
1 Input
1 Output
-
375fcf724e523e138e4e8de12b714fe3620b84ed7814106bc29aa9c3896aa723:0
- value
- 109504422
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7ae8a856012fc55a9a590a57df1b387204f2a9dd OP_EQUAL
- address
- 3Ctu5H55sChfRErE7bPu5ypxcy43WVzyJW